-#sbs-git:slp/api/wav-player capi-media-wav-player 0.1.0 8d904bb3bd0ca7fa01ebd8f4185e4b993d94c08d
Name: capi-media-wav-player
Summary: A wav player library in Tizen C API
-Version: 0.1.0
-Release: 16
-Group: TO_BE/FILLED_IN
-License: Apache License, Version 2.0
+Version: 0.2.3
+Release: 0
+Group: Multimedia/API
+License: Apache-2.0
Source0: %{name}-%{version}.tar.gz
+Source1001: capi-media-wav-player.manifest
BuildRequires: cmake
BuildRequires: pkgconfig(mm-sound)
BuildRequires: pkgconfig(dlog)
BuildRequires: pkgconfig(capi-base-common)
BuildRequires: pkgconfig(capi-media-sound-manager)
-Requires(post): /sbin/ldconfig
-Requires(postun): /sbin/ldconfig
%description
-
+A wav player library in Tizen C API.
%package devel
Summary: A wav player library in Tizen C API (Development)
-Group: TO_BE/FILLED_IN
+Group: Development/Multimedia
Requires: %{name} = %{version}-%{release}
%description devel
-
-
+%devel_desc
%prep
%setup -q
-
+cp %{SOURCE1001} .
%build
-MAJORVER=`echo %{version} | awk 'BEGIN {FS="."}{print $1}'`
-cmake . -DCMAKE_INSTALL_PREFIX=/usr -DFULLVER=%{version} -DMAJORVER=${MAJORVER}
+%if 0%{?gcov:1}
+export CFLAGS+=" -fprofile-arcs -ftest-coverage"
+export CXXFLAGS+=" -fprofile-arcs -ftest-coverage"
+export LDFLAGS+=" -lgcov"
+%endif
-make %{?jobs:-j%jobs}
+MAJORVER=`echo %{version} | awk 'BEGIN {FS="."}{print $1}'`
+%cmake . -DFULLVER=%{version} -DMAJORVER=${MAJORVER} \
+%if "%{tizen_profile_name}" != "tv"
+ -DTIZEN_FEATURE_TESTSUITE=On
+%else
+ -DTIZEN_FEATURE_TESTSUITE=Off
+%endif
+%__make %{?jobs:-j%jobs}
%install
-rm -rf %{buildroot}
-mkdir -p %{buildroot}/usr/share/license
-cp LICENSE.APLv2 %{buildroot}/usr/share/license/%{name}
-
%make_install
%post -p /sbin/ldconfig
%postun -p /sbin/ldconfig
-
%files
+%manifest %{name}.manifest
+%license LICENSE.APLv2
%{_libdir}/libcapi-media-wav-player.so.*
-%{_datadir}/license/%{name}
-%manifest capi-media-wav-player.manifest
+%if "%{tizen_profile_name}" != "tv"
+%{_bindir}/wav_player_test
+%endif
%files devel
+%manifest %{name}.manifest
%{_includedir}/media/*.h
%{_libdir}/pkgconfig/*.pc
%{_libdir}/libcapi-media-wav-player.so